body {
	margin: auto;
	background-color: #FCD884;
	font-family: "Times New Roman", Times, serif;
	font-size: 15px;
	scrollbar-face-color:#F4ECD5;
scrollbar-highlight-color:#FFFFFF;
scrollbar-3dlight-color:#C0C0C0;
scrollbar-darkshadow-color:#000000;
scrollbar-shadow-color:#808080;
scrollbar-arrow-color:#FFFFFF;
scrollbar-track-color:#FCD884;

}
td {
	vertical-align: top;
}
#cotemeuble {
	position: absolute;
	width: 280px;
	left: 674px;
	top: 249px;
	line-height: 20px;
	
}

/* GALERIE */
/* needed for IE to make :active state work first time */
a, a:visited {color:#000;} 

a.gallery, a.gallery:visited {display:block; 
display:inline-block; 
color:#000; text-decoration:none; 
border:0px solid #000; width:81px; height:80px; 
float:left; 
margin: auto 25px 0px auto; z-index:50;}
a.slidea {background: url(../images/foto1-v.jpg);}
a.slideb {background:url(../images/foto2-v.jpg);}
a.slidec {background:url(../images/foto3-v.jpg);}
a.slided {background:url(../images/foto4-v.jpg);}
a.slidee {background:url(../images/foto25-v.jpg);}
a.slidef {background:url(../images/foto26-v.jpg);}
a.gallery em, a.gallery span {display:none;}
a.gallery:hover {border:0px solid #fff;}


/* styling for TOP gallery */
#container_top {position: absolute; 
width: 619px; 
height: 325px; 
top: 200px;
left: 333px;
background: transparent; 
border:0px solid #a49188; 
margin:1em auto;}
#container_top img {border:0;}
#container_top .thumbs {position:absolute; left:0; top:0;}
#container_top a.gallery:hover span {display:block; 
position:absolute; 
width:322px; height:120px; 
top:200px; left:5px; padding:5px; 
font-style:italic; color: Maroon;  z-index:100;}
#container_top a.gallery:hover span:first-line {font-style:normal; 
font-weight:bold; font-size:1em; color:#000;}
#container_top a.gallery:active, #container_top a.gallery:focus {border:0px solid #000;}
#container_top a.gallery:active em, #container_top a.gallery:focus em {
display:block; position:absolute; 
width:532px; height:340px; top:270px; left:35px; padding:5px; color:#000; border:1px solid #3d330f; z-index:50;}
#container_top h1 {clear:both; margin:0; padding-top:280px;text-align:center; }

/* GALERIE MEUBLES*/

a.galleryc, a.galleryc:visited {display:block; 
display:inline-block; 
color:#000; text-decoration:none; 
border:0px solid #000; width:81px; height:80px; 
float:left; 
margin: auto 25px 0px auto; z-index:50;}
a.slideac {background: url(../images/foto31-v.jpg);}
a.slidebc {background:url(../images/foto8-v.jpg);}
a.slidecc {background:url(../images/foto29-v.jpg);}
a.slidedc {background:url(../images/foto20-v.jpg);}
a.slideec {background:url(../images/foto27-v.jpg);}
a.slidefc {background:url(../images/foto12-v.jpg);}
a.galleryc em, a.galleryc span {display:none;}
a.galleryc:hover {border:0px solid #fff;}


/* styling for TOP gallery */
#container_topc {position: absolute; 
width: 619px; 
height: 325px; 
top: 200px;
left: 333px;
background: transparent; 
border:0px solid #a49188; 
margin:1em auto;}
#container_topc img {border:0;}
#container_topc .thumbsc {position:absolute; left:0; top:0;}
#container_topc a.galleryc:hover span {display:block; 
position:absolute; 
width:322px; height:120px; 
top:200px; left:5px; padding:5px; 
font-style:italic; color: Maroon;  z-index:100;}
#container_topc a.galleryc:hover span:first-line {font-style:normal; 
font-weight:bold; font-size:1em; color:#000;}
#container_topc a.galleryc:active, #container_topc a.galleryc:focus {border:0px solid #000;}
#container_topc a.galleryc:active em, #container_topc a.galleryc:focus em {
display:block; position:absolute; 
width:532px; height:340px; top:270px; left:35px; padding:5px; color:#000; border:1px solid #3d330f; z-index:50;}
#container_topc h1 {clear:both; margin:0; padding-top:280px;text-align:center; }

/* CONTACT */

#menu {
	width: 530px;
	float: left;
	margin: 62px auto auto 103px;
}
#nome {
	float: left;
	text-align: center;
	color : #FCD884; 
font-weight: bold;
font-size : 19px;
line-height: 37px;
}
#accueil, #cuisines, #contact {
	width: 105px;
	float: left;
	text-align: center;
	
}
#accueil a.lien, #cuisines a.lien, #contact a.lien {
color : #F4ECD5; 
text-decoration: none;
font-weight: bold;
font-size : 18px;
line-height: 18px;
}
#accueil a.lien:hover, #cuisines a.lien:hover, #contact a.lien:hover {
color : #FCD884; 
text-decoration: underline;
}

#adress {
	text-align:center;
	font-weight: bold,; 
	font-size: 20px;
	margin-top: 31px;
	line-height: 26px;
	color: #251012;
}

#footer {
	text-align:center;
	font-weight: bold,; 
	font-size: 10px;
	line-height: 16px;
	color: Gray;
}
#footer a {
color: Gray;
}
#footer a:hover {
color: Black;
}

